    How many unit cells are present in a cube-shaped ideal crystal of \[NaCl\]of mass \[1.00\text{ }g\]? [Atomic masses:\[Na=23,\text{ }Cl=35.5\]]

    A) \[5.14\times {{10}^{21}}\]unit cells  

    B) \[1.28\times {{10}^{21}}\]unit cells

    C) \[1.71\times {{10}^{21}}\]unit cells  

    D) \[2.57\times {{10}^{21}}\]unit cells

    Correct Answer: D

    Solution :

    Since in \[NaCl\]type structure 4 formula units form a cell. \[58.5\text{ }g\]of \[NaCl=6.023\times {{10}^{23}}\]atoms \[1g\] of \[NaCl=\frac{6.023\times {{10}^{23}}}{58.5}\]atoms atoms constitute 1 unit cell \[\therefore \,\,\frac{6.023\times {{10}^{23}}}{58.5}\] atoms constitute \[=\frac{6.023\times {{10}^{23}}}{58.5\times 4}=2.57\times {{10}^{21}}\] unit cells.
